Description

The City of Sedona is considering an Intergovernmental Agreement with the Yavapai County Flood Control District to contribute up to $520,400 for design and construction of general drainage improvement projects at several city locations. Council will discuss and possibly approve the resolution authorizing execution of this IGA.
